Back in 1985, Los Angeles debuted the nation's first ever 24 hour, 7 days a week all rap radio station with 1580 AM Stereo, KDAY! KDAY is back on L.A.'s 93.5FM... The Rock Steady Crew will be celebrating their 20th anniversary of "Beat Street" this coming October 30th at The Point C.D.C. (940 Garrison Ave., Bronx, NY). Hosted By Crazy Legs, RSC, DJ Slynkee, Forrest Getemgump and more TBA. Admission is $10.00 & here's a rundown of the activities for "Beat Street":

Panel Discussions
12:00 PM – 1:30 PM “Don’t Judge Me”
This topic will cover how judges pick and choose winners as well as what they’re looking for in battles. What is a fair judging system? And what qualifications should a judge have?
Panelist: TBA


1:45 PM – 2:45 PM “The Art Of the Jam”.
Promoters will discuss what goes on behind the scenes when preparing for a jam and what it takes to throw a big event. This panel will try to give the consumer of these events and future promoters a better idea on how to throw their own events. As well as ask questions about past events and what went wrong or right?
Panelist: Crazy Legs , Cros 1, Forrest Getemgump, Keebla and more TBA.


3:00 PM- 4:00 PM “Soled Out!!” (Who’s Gone Hollywood?) Discussing who is and what is selling out in the breaking world”. Is doing what you love to make money really selling out? And how b-boys & b-girls sell themselves short just to be a part of a project. Why it is important to set a standard for getting paid in videos, commercials etc.
Panelist: Lady Jules, Moy and more TBA


Screening Of Beat Street 4:15 – 6:PM
FRIENEMIES JAM 7:00 – 2:00 AM Until. It's all about representing in the circles. Every b-boy and b-girl for himself or herself! No preset set battles. Back in the early eighties breaking was at an all time high through out the world. Crews were rolling thick and a lot of them got along. The only time they didn't get along was when they hit the club. I remember RSC and NYCB rolling to Places like Negril, The Roxy, Kennedy High School and other places where jams were going down. No one was worried about hurting any ones feelings or concerned with battling their own friends with a fierce will to win. We were all "FRIENEMIES". This is the place to battle that person that you chill with on a regular basis and show him that he's not as good as he brags about all the time. After that you jump on the train together and go to the next spot and have a laugh. We just want to keep the essence alive.

I caught up with Maximus recently & here's what's upper with our homeboy; " It's hard to believe, but I started my radio show in Vancouver on CFRO 102.7FM exactly TEN years ago in October, 1994. During that time, the show has had many milestones including being Vancouver's first 24 hour Hip Hop radio marathons. Vancouver then, as it is again now, had no urban music stations so all of Vancouver's hip hop radio audience became affixed to the radio whenever the show aired. Celebrity guests included Daz, Del, Cocoa Brovas, WC, Grandmaster Flash, KRS One, Too Short, Raekwon, DJ Honda, X-ecutioners, and Tribe.
